Jeroen Peeters

Through the Back: Situating vision between moving bodies

debate book presentation

Through the Back: Situating vision between moving bodies
Through the Back: Situating vision between moving bodies
Kaaistudio's
Sat 10.05.14

Through the Back: Situating Vision between Moving Bodies seeks to articulate this critical potential in a series of essays that explores the work of experimental choreographers active throughout the noughties: Alexander Baervoets, Boris Charmatz, Meg Stuart, Benoît Lachambre, Vera Mantero, Philipp Gehmacher, Jennifer Lacey and Nadia Lauro, and deufert & plischke.

Bleri Lleshi

De neoliberale strafstaat

debate book presentation

De neoliberale strafstaat
De neoliberale strafstaat
Kaaitheater
Tue 25.03.14

The gap between rich and poor in Belgium has never been so big. One Belgian in five has difficulty making ends meet. One immigrant child in three grows up in poverty. This makes Belgium one of the worst pupils in the European class. But what is near the top of the political agenda? Criminality. Safety. Zero tolerance. Public nuisance. Loitering teenagers. But it should not be all one-sided. When they do not succeed in tackling the real problems, politicians always come back to the same thing: repression, as the political philosopher Bleri Lleshi says in De neoliberale strafstaat. On the basis of theoretical research and practical experience, Lleshi shows where thirty years of neoliberalism is rapidly leading us.

Lieven De Cauter & Rudi Laermans

The Return of the Nature State

debate book presentation

The Return of the Nature State
The Return of the Nature State
Fri 29.03.13

On the occasion of the publication of his book Entropic Empire, On the City of Man in the Age of Disaster, the cultural philosopher Lieven De Cauter will be talking to his co-author, the sociologist Rudi Laermans, about the old and new ‘nature states’, new relationships between humans and non-humans, and animality, bio-politics and cosmo-politics.
